What is Intelligent Motor Control for Large Fans and Pumps?

Intelligent Motor Control is a cutting-edge solution designed specifically for large fans and pumps in mining and metals industries. It manages motors up to 90MW currently under control, focusing on both low voltage and high voltage systems (up to 13.8kV). This includes a variety of fans such as C/T fans, ID/FD fans, bagging house fans, boiler feed pumps, vacuum pumps, and ventilation fans commonly found in mining operations. The system is delivered as an Energy Efficiency As-a-Service model, meaning clients get zero-capex installation and operation, with guaranteed minimum net GWh savings contractually promised. The approach combines expertise in design, assembly, integration, and maintenance, all while ensuring the client’s staff remains focused on production.

How the Project Ensures Production Uptime

One of the standout features of the Intelligent Motor Control system is its focus on production uptime. The e-houses are installed with a fully motorized bypass, which means zero risk of unplanned downtime. This is critical in mining and metals industries where any unexpected halt can be costly. The system also includes sealed energy meters for precise consumption measurement, verified against third-party baselines to ensure the savings are real and transparent. This combination of reliability and accountability makes it a trusted solution for energy-intensive users.

Energy Efficiency as a Service: A Zero-Capex Solution

This project operates on an Energy Efficiency as-a-Service model, which means clients don’t have to worry about upfront capital expenditure. The entire system is fully funded and operated by the service provider, delivering guaranteed energy savings with minimal risk. The assessment phase is quick, with a go/no-go decision made in under 30 days, and new accounts typically onboarded within 3 to 6 months. Expansion projects can be completed in less than 45 days, and operational e-houses are deployed within 6 to 12 months. Contracts include a 10-year service level agreement, after which clients can opt for a reduced fee SLA or purchase the e-house outright.
